Gofundme collects money to make a body of construction workers. To send to Ecuador

A Gofundme campaign collects money to send the body of a River Construction Worker case in Ecuador after his death last week on a Martha win.

Jorge Marcelo Yanza Riera, 33, died after he was injured on April 22nd in an accident in the 14 Trapps Pond Road in Edgartown. According to the Vineyard Times from Martha, he fell from some scaffolding shortly before 3 p.m. 20 to 30 feet.

Riera died on home ownership, whose owner of the newspaper said that the construction worker was employed in a River officer case. The occupational safety authority (Osha) examines Riera's death, reported the Vineyard Times of the Martha.

Riera came from Ecuador to the United States a little more than two years ago, “in the hope of building a better future and supporting his family at home, his brother Angel Yanza Riera wrote on the Gofundme campaign page.

“Jorge was a young man full of life, hardworking, always with a smile and ready to reach everyone who needed it. His sudden departure left an immense emptiness in our hearts,” wrote his brother.

The money collected by the campaign will go to the funeral and transport of his body from Riera to Ecuador, where his parents live, wrote his brother on the campaign side. From Tuesday evening, the campaign was far from reaching its 9,000 US dollar after collecting just a little more than $ 1,000.
